No city holds such beauty.  Here, the mind can wander and the body can relax.  The birds fill the skies and the deer don’t mind you if you don’t mind them. Make sure your shoes are sturdy for a car cannot traverse the winding path.

The towering trees keep you cool as you pass ferns and other flora. Should you need to rest, there will be an accommodating rock. You are following the song of the water.

As the branches part, you gasp in awe for they reveal the dance between stream and gravity. You’ve found your true soulmate.
